Northrop Grumman Aeronautics Systems Sector has an opening for an Engineer Software or Principal Engineer Software to join Global Surveillance Division supporting the team of qualified, diverse individuals. This position will be located in Melbourne, Florida.

Responsibilities will include designing, testing, maintaining, troubleshooting, and improving the systems and software. The role requires you to have hands on technical experience and a can-do approach towards environment automation and management along with continuous improvements.

You will be a team member working in agile development process. You will be responsible for the design and implementation of application builds, releases, deployment along with configuration activities. Your responsibilities will include working with internal business partners to gather requirements, prototyping, and architecting complex solutions supporting the building and test plan execution, performing quality reviews, and triaging and fixing operational issues. The candidate will assist with the integration, troubleshooting and testing of implemented software changes. The ideal candidate will have the ability to take ownership of an ambiguous hard problems and drive to a solution, while working in a team environment. It is critical that you understand the software development life cycle and have an in-depth knowledge of automated testing to facilitate and analyze large data sets. The Software Engineer will develop, modify, and maintain customized or standardized applications using software engineering best practices and standards, and participate in the full life cycle of software development, to include requirements development, modeling and design, application development, unit to CSCI testing, integration, formal system testing, release, installation, and maintenance.

Essential Functions:
•    Full lifecycle design, implementation, and unit testing of software
•    Work with various team members to integrate functionality with other software components.
•    Supporting the gathering and reporting software metrics.
•    Follow program software best practices.
•    Develop software products within all phases of the software lifecycle.

Basic Qualifications:
•    (Engineer Software T02) bachelor’s degree in a Science, Technology, Engineering, or Mathematics (STEM) discipline and 2 or more years of experience in software engineering
OR a Master’s degree in a Science, Technology, Engineering, or Mathematics (STEM) discipline and 0 or more years of experience in software engineering
•    (Principal Engineer Software T03) bachelor’s degree in a Science, Technology, Engineering, or Mathematics (STEM) discipline and 5 or more years of experience in software engineering
OR a Master’s degree in a Science, Technology, Engineering, or Mathematics (STEM) discipline and 3 or more years of experience in software engineering
OR a PhD degree in a Science, Technology, Engineering, or Mathematics (STEM) discipline and 1 or more years of experience in software engineering.
•    Development experience with C/C++ languages.
•    Experience developing software in a Linux or Windows environment.
•    Excellent oral and written communication skills and Strong interpersonal skills.
•    US citizen with ability to transfer and maintain a DoD Secret level security clearance. Clearance is required to start.
•    Ability to obtain and maintain special program access.
•    Willingness to work off-peak for short term surge support to meet program milestones
 Preferred Qualifications:
•    Familiarity with the Atlassian tool suite with add-ons like Git and Confluence.
•    Experience with C/C++ desktop application development
•    Experience with multithreaded desktop application development
•    Familiarity with the Agile software development process.
•    Full software development life cycle experience.
•    Experience with DOORS and/or Cameo UML Modeling experience or similar tools.
•    Experience with formal software test and Weapon System evaluations.
•    US citizen with a current in scope DoD secret or higher clearance.
•    Currently the holder of a special program access.
 

Primary Level Salary Range: $79,300.00 - $118,900.00Secondary Level Salary Range: $98,400.00 - $147,600.00

The above salary range represents a general guideline; however, Northrop Grumman considers a number of factors when determining base salary offers such as the scope and responsibilities of the position and the candidate's experience, education, skills and current market conditions.

Depending on the position, employees may be eligible for overtime, shift differential, and a discretionary bonus in addition to base pay. Annual bonuses are designed to reward individual contributions as well as allow employees to share in company results. Employees in Vice President or Director positions may be eligible for Long Term Incentives. In addition, Northrop Grumman provides a variety of benefits including health insurance coverage, life and disability insurance, savings plan, Company paid holidays and paid time off (PTO) for vacation and/or personal business.
